Bondage Curiosity and Fulfillment

Kate is curious about bondage, all the more so after she reads her roommate's diary and realizes she's just rebuffed a hot date because he wanted to handcuff her. Whether or not reading someone's diary is the right thing to do, it's a sexy sort of spying, and builds Kate's anticipation. She is bold enough to seek out restraints for herself, in a tantalizing sex toy store scene, one of the things I liked most about this short story--that this bondage newbie wasn't just waiting for bondage to come to her, but seeking it out. Does she find it? Oh yes, and it's even better than her fantasies, but I think the buildup here is the best part, as Kate fantasizes about what surrendering will feel like. Is Kate perfect? No, but that doesn't make her any less compelling of a character, and if you're into bondage (or curious about it like Kate), you'll want to check out Cuffing Kate.
